Xtant Medical Exhibits
at North American Spine Society (NASS) Meeting
October 12, 2015 - Xtant Medical Holdings, Inc. (OTCQX:BONE),
a leader in the development of regenerative medicine products and medical devices, today announced that its wholly owned subsidiaries,
X-spine Systems Inc. and Bacterin International, Inc. are sponsoring the 30th Annual North American Spine Society (NASS) Meeting.
Xtant Medical will display X-spine and Bacterin product portfolios during the meeting in Chicago, IL from October 14 th -
Xtant Medical will feature the
recently FDA cleared Aranax Cervical Plating System and the OsteoSelect PLUS DBM Putty, while highlighting the Irix-A
Integrated Lumbar System, Silex Sacroiliac Fusion System, Axle Interspinous Fusion System, 3Demin Cortical Fiber
Technology, and the OsteoSponge product family.
Xtant will also be hosting a
cadaveric product demonstration highlighting proprietary fixation products on Wednesday, October 14 from 2-4pm at the McCormick
Convention Center. "Showcasing the product portfolio at NASS allows us to present our development and commercialization capabilities
directly to surgeon users and distributors," said Dr. David Kirschman, Chief Scientific Officer and Executive Vice President
of Xtant Medical. "This also provides a platform to assess our strengths as a manufacturer as well as to identify new potential
market opportunities within the spine community."

About Xtant Medical Holdings
Xtant Medical Holdings, Inc.
(OTCQX:BONE) develops, manufactures and markets class-leading regenerative medicine products and medical devices for domestic and
international markets. Xtant products serve the specialized needs of orthopedic and neurological surgeons, including orthobiologics for
the promotion of bone healing, implants and instrumentation for the treatment of spinal disease, tissue grafts for the treatment
of orthopedic disorders, and biologics to promote healing following cranial, and foot and ankle surgeries. With core competencies
in both biologic and non-biologic surgical technologies, Xtant can leverage its resources to successfully compete in global neurological
and orthopedic surgery markets. For further information, please visit www.xtantmedical.com.
